About this Event

Join us for a rare industry event where freelancers get to steer the conversation.

Freelancers Unconferenced opens the floor to five freelancers in the arts, culture, and heritage sector, who will speak on a subject they are passionate about. Those freelancers then choose a dedicated section of the room to continue their conversation with the audience, who will have the choice of which conversation they'd like to be part of.

For this pilot event, we've chosen the theme of leadership, which is a hot topic of conversation at North East Cultural Freelancers. Freelancers are leaders - but they don't always think of themselves that way. We're inviting our freelance community to take ownership of their position as leaders and decide how they want to lead.

The main speaker will speak for five minutes and will be selected from the previous graduates of our Cultural Leadership Programme. If you're a freelancer and you'd like to take one of the four regular speaker slots, which are 2-3 minutes long, please fill in this form by Friday 31 October: Freelancers Unconferenced speaker pitch. Speakers will be informed of our decision by Monday 3 November and will be paid a fee of £150.

This event isn't just for freelancers; we invite those working for cultural organisations, local authorities and funders to come and hear what's important to the freelance workforce. If you're able to, we ask that you buy a donation ticket to support this and future events.

Thanks to Creative Central: NCL, we have a small number of £50 bursaries available to freelancers who require financial support to attend. To apply, email [email protected] with a few lines on why you’d like to attend and how it supports your work. If applications exceed availability, we’ll prioritise freelancers based in Newcastle and those from backgrounds currently under-represented in the cultural sector.

This event is supported by Creative Central NCL, with in-kind support from Tyne Theatre & Opera House.
